EAGLES SPEECH TEAM TO STATE

Place 4th in Competition

by Amanda Hovendick

March 27, 2007

 

Milford High School qualified 11 students who participated in the Nebraska State High School Speech Tournament.  Those students were:  Brandy Frey, Josh Wiley, Clee Shy, Shannon Arena, Chase Jones, Alex Hull, Brad Rediger, Savana Riley, Sarah Penry, Cori Curtis, and Hannah Troyer. 

 

The tournament was held at Kearney on March 15, 2007.  Each qualifier performed twice in the preliminary rounds to determine contestants in final competition.  Usually the top six contestants make it into finals; in case of a tie, then there are more finalists.

Those making it into finals were:  Cori Curtis in Persuasive and Poetry; Sarah Penry in Persuasive; Brad Rediger in Informative and Duet; and Savana Riley in Duet.  The OID (Oral Interpretation of Drama) team of Savana Riley, Chase Jones, Shannon Arena, and Clee Shy narrowly missed going into finals by one point and ended up 7th in the competition.

Congratulations to the Milford speech team for finishing the year 4th out of 56 C-1 schools.  Individual medalists were Sarah Penry, 5th in Persuasive; Brad Rediger, 4th in Informative; and Cori Curtis, State Runner-Up in Persuasive and State Champion in Poetry.  Brad and Savana also placed 8th Duet Acting. 

 

The state meet capped an extremely successful season for the Milford Speech Team.  Congratulations to the entire team for a very successful season.  The team is coached by Audrey Mathiesen.
